diff options
author | Matsuu Takuto <matsuu@gentoo.org> | 2009-07-22 15:31:46 +0000 |
---|---|---|
committer | Matsuu Takuto <matsuu@gentoo.org> | 2009-07-22 15:31:46 +0000 |
commit | 4b55a9028a090df9c893e7970b01aa960e925b02 (patch) | |
tree | 30e95034d2dbfa7da5e3ab1610344b37929bb1d2 /app-i18n | |
parent | arm/ia64/s390/sh stable wrt #275595 (diff) | |
download | gentoo-2-4b55a9028a090df9c893e7970b01aa960e925b02.tar.gz gentoo-2-4b55a9028a090df9c893e7970b01aa960e925b02.tar.bz2 gentoo-2-4b55a9028a090df9c893e7970b01aa960e925b02.zip |
Fixed parallel make issue, bug #253611.
(Portage version: 2.1.6.13/cvs/Linux x86_64)
Diffstat (limited to 'app-i18n')
-rw-r--r-- | app-i18n/skim/ChangeLog | 6 | ||||
-rw-r--r-- | app-i18n/skim/skim-1.4.5-r3.ebuild | 84 | ||||
-rw-r--r-- | app-i18n/skim/skim-1.4.5-r4.ebuild | 86 | ||||
-rw-r--r-- | app-i18n/skim/skim-1.4.5-r5.ebuild | 13 |
4 files changed, 15 insertions, 174 deletions
diff --git a/app-i18n/skim/ChangeLog b/app-i18n/skim/ChangeLog index 0c4844641970..4271ed21393b 100644 --- a/app-i18n/skim/ChangeLog +++ b/app-i18n/skim/ChangeLog @@ -1,6 +1,10 @@ # ChangeLog for app-i18n/skim # Copyright 1999-2009 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/app-i18n/skim/ChangeLog,v 1.71 2009/07/21 00:49:22 jer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-i18n/skim/ChangeLog,v 1.72 2009/07/22 15:31:46 matsuu Exp $ + + 22 Jul 2009; MATSUU Takuto <matsuu@gentoo.org> -skim-1.4.5-r3.ebuild, + -skim-1.4.5-r4.ebuild, skim-1.4.5-r5.ebuild: + Fixed parallel make issue, bug #253611. 21 Jul 2009; Jeroen Roovers <jer@gentoo.org> skim-1.4.5-r5.ebuild: Stable for HPPA (bug #277353). diff --git a/app-i18n/skim/skim-1.4.5-r3.ebuild b/app-i18n/skim/skim-1.4.5-r3.ebuild deleted file mode 100644 index 9395820b81e0..000000000000 --- a/app-i18n/skim/skim-1.4.5-r3.ebuild +++ /dev/null @@ -1,84 +0,0 @@ -# Copyright 2000-2009 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-i18n/skim/skim-1.4.5-r3.ebuild,v 1.1 2009/01/29 14:29:25 matsuu Exp $ - -inherit kde-functions multilib toolchain-funcs eutils - -DESCRIPTION="Smart Common Input Method (SCIM) optimized for KDE" -HOMEPAGE="http://www.scim-im.org/" -SRC_URI="mirror://sourceforge/scim/${P}.tar.bz2 - http://freedesktop.org/~cougar/skim/downloads/${P}.tar.bz2" - -LICENSE="GPL-2" -SLOT="0" -KEYWORDS="~alpha ~amd64 ~hppa ~ppc ~ppc64 ~sparc ~x86 ~x86-fbsd" -IUSE="" - -RDEPEND=">=app-i18n/scim-1.4.4" -DEPEND="${RDEPEND} - dev-util/pkgconfig" - -need-kde 3.2 - -src_unpack() { - unpack ${A} - cd "${S}" - - epatch "${FILESDIR}/${P}-asneeded.patch" - # bug #211493 - epatch "${FILESDIR}/${P}-kde3.patch" - # - epatch "${FILESDIR}/${P}-klineedit.patch" - - sed -i -e "s:/opt/kde3:${KDEDIR}:g" doc/de/index.docbook || die - # bug #246223 - ln -s libscim-kdeutils.so.0.1.0 utils/libscim-kdeutils.so || die -} - -src_compile() { - local sconsopts=$(echo "${MAKEOPTS}" | sed -e "s/.*\(-j[0-9]\+\).*/\1/") - [ "${MAKEOPTS/-s/}" != "${MAKEOPTS}" ] && sconsopts="${sconsopts} -s" - - ./configure prefix=/usr libdir=/usr/$(get_libdir) || die - # bug #255210 - epatch "${FILESDIR}/${P}-python26.patch" - sed -i -e "/^compilers/s:\[:\['$(tc-getCXX)',:" scons-local-0.96.1/SCons/Tool/g++.py || die - ./scons ${sconsopts} || die -} - -src_install() { - DESTDIR="${D}" ./scons prefix=/usr install || die - - # Install the .desktop file in FDO's suggested directory - dodir /usr/share/applications/kde - mv "${D}/usr/share/applnk/Utilities/skim.desktop" \ - "${D}/usr/share/applications/kde" - - dodoc ChangeLog AUTHORS NEWS README TODO - mv "${D}/usr/share/doc/HTML" "${D}/usr/share/doc/${PF}/html" -} - -pkg_postinst() { - elog - elog "If you want to use Chinese interface, edit your startup script" - elog "such as .xinitrc to incorporate" - elog - elog ' export XMODIFIERS=@im=SCIM' - elog ' export QT_IM_MODULE=scim' - elog ' export GTK_IM_MODULE=scim' - elog ' export LANG="zh_CN.GBK"' - elog ' startkde' - elog - elog "or if you prefer English interface," - elog - elog ' export XMODIFIERS=@im=SCIM' - elog ' export QT_IM_MODULE=scim' - elog ' export GTK_IM_MODULE=scim' - elog ' export LC_CTYPE="zh_CN.GBK"' - elog ' startkde' - elog - elog "and start skim and SCIM by" - elog - elog " % skim -d" - elog -} diff --git a/app-i18n/skim/skim-1.4.5-r4.ebuild b/app-i18n/skim/skim-1.4.5-r4.ebuild deleted file mode 100644 index 1e2522d44e76..000000000000 --- a/app-i18n/skim/skim-1.4.5-r4.ebuild +++ /dev/null @@ -1,86 +0,0 @@ -# Copyright 2000-2009 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-i18n/skim/skim-1.4.5-r4.ebuild,v 1.1 2009/02/14 01:22:00 matsuu Exp $ - -inherit kde-functions multilib toolchain-funcs eutils - -DESCRIPTION="Smart Common Input Method (SCIM) optimized for KDE" -HOMEPAGE="http://www.scim-im.org/" -SRC_URI="mirror://sourceforge/scim/${P}.tar.bz2 - http://freedesktop.org/~cougar/skim/downloads/${P}.tar.bz2" - -LICENSE="GPL-2" -SLOT="0" -KEYWORDS="~alpha ~amd64 ~hppa ~ppc ~ppc64 ~sparc ~x86 ~x86-fbsd" -IUSE="" - -RDEPEND=">=app-i18n/scim-1.4.4" -DEPEND="${RDEPEND} - dev-util/pkgconfig" - -need-kde 3.2 - -src_unpack() { - unpack ${A} - cd "${S}" - - epatch "${FILESDIR}/${P}-asneeded.patch" - # bug #211493 - epatch "${FILESDIR}/${P}-kde3.patch" - # - epatch "${FILESDIR}/${P}-klineedit.patch" - - sed -i -e "/^env =/s:(:(CXX='$(tc-getCXX)', :" SConstruct || die - - sed -i -e "s:/opt/kde3:${KDEDIR}:g" doc/de/index.docbook || die - - # bug #246223 - ln -s libscim-kdeutils.so.0.1.0 utils/libscim-kdeutils.so || die - - # bug #255210 - tar xjf bksys/scons-mini.tar.bz2 || die - epatch "${FILESDIR}/${P}-python26.patch" -} - -src_compile() { - local sconsopts=$(echo "${MAKEOPTS}" | sed -e "s/.*\(-j[0-9]\+\).*/\1/") - [ "${MAKEOPTS/-s/}" != "${MAKEOPTS}" ] && sconsopts="${sconsopts} -s" - ./scons ${sconsopts} || die -} - -src_install() { - DESTDIR="${D}" ./scons prefix=/usr install || die - - # Install the .desktop file in FDO's suggested directory - dodir /usr/share/applications/kde - mv "${D}/usr/share/applnk/Utilities/skim.desktop" \ - "${D}/usr/share/applications/kde" - - dodoc ChangeLog AUTHORS NEWS README TODO - mv "${D}/usr/share/doc/HTML" "${D}/usr/share/doc/${PF}/html" -} - -pkg_postinst() { - elog - elog "If you want to use Chinese interface, edit your startup script" - elog "such as .xinitrc to incorporate" - elog - elog ' export XMODIFIERS=@im=SCIM' - elog ' export QT_IM_MODULE=scim' - elog ' export GTK_IM_MODULE=scim' - elog ' export LANG="zh_CN.GBK"' - elog ' startkde' - elog - elog "or if you prefer English interface," - elog - elog ' export XMODIFIERS=@im=SCIM' - elog ' export QT_IM_MODULE=scim' - elog ' export GTK_IM_MODULE=scim' - elog ' export LC_CTYPE="zh_CN.GBK"' - elog ' startkde' - elog - elog "and start skim and SCIM by" - elog - elog " % skim -d" - elog -} diff --git a/app-i18n/skim/skim-1.4.5-r5.ebuild b/app-i18n/skim/skim-1.4.5-r5.ebuild index d5b6ec7c9a40..e341bf8f2e4a 100644 --- a/app-i18n/skim/skim-1.4.5-r5.ebuild +++ b/app-i18n/skim/skim-1.4.5-r5.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2009 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-i18n/skim/skim-1.4.5-r5.ebuild,v 1.4 2009/07/21 00:49:22 jer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-i18n/skim/skim-1.4.5-r5.ebuild,v 1.5 2009/07/22 15:31:46 matsuu Exp $ inherit kde-functions multilib toolchain-funcs eutils @@ -44,8 +44,15 @@ src_unpack() { } src_compile() { - local sconsopts=$(echo "${MAKEOPTS}" | sed -e "s/.*\(-j[0-9]\+\).*/\1/") - [ "${MAKEOPTS/-s/}" != "${MAKEOPTS}" ] && sconsopts="${sconsopts} -s" + local sconsopts="" + # parallel make b0rked, bug #253611 + #if [ "${MAKEOPTS/-j/}" != "${MAKEOPTS}" ] ; then + # local jobs=$(echo "${MAKEOPTS}" | sed -e "s/.*-j[^0-9]*\([0-9]\+\).*/\1/") + # sconsopts="${sconsopts} -j ${jobs}" + #fi + if [ "${MAKEOPTS/-s/}" != "${MAKEOPTS}" ] ; then + sconsopts="${sconsopts} -s" + fi ./scons ${sconsopts} || die } |